Youssef is a man with a life so large, he has to be played by four actors.

In this fast-paced comedy, a surgeon from the Middle East arrives in London in search of work and a new life. Instead, through a series of hilarious mistakes and hapless missteps, he runs afoul of both white nationalists and liberal hypocrites discovering some surprising truths about the way we view the immigrants among us.

Starring Christopher Daftsios*, Rami Margron*, Max Samuels* and Nazli Sarpkaya*
